Program enot;
Var n,s,i:integer;
begin
read(n);
s:=0;
for i:= 1 to n do
if i mod 2 = 0 then
s:=s+i;
writeln('summa = ',s);
end.<span>
2.</span>Program enot;
Var n,p,i:integer;
begin
read(n);
p:=1;
for i:= 1 to n do p:=p*i;
writeln('proizvedenie = ',p);
<span>end.</span>
Зажать home и блокировку. Устройство выключится.
1)
var
x,y,s:real;
begin
readln(x,y);
s:=abs(x*y);
writeln(s:8:2);
end.
2)
var
a:integer;
begin
readln(a);
if a mod 2=0 then writeln("четное число")
else writeln("нечетное число")ж
end.
var n,i,k,a: integer;
begin
readln(n);
k:=0;
for i:=1 to n do begin
readln (a);
if (a div 3 <> 0) and (a mod 10 = 2) then
k:=k+1;
end;
writeln(k);
end.
Var x : array[1..100] of integer;
n,i,s,b : integer;
begin
write('n = ');
readln(n);
writeln('Исходный массив:');
for i:=1 to n do begin
write('x[',i,']=');
readln(x[i]);
end;
writeln;
s:=0;
for i:=1 to n div 2 do
begin
b:=x[i]; x[i]:=x[n+1-i]; x[n+1-i]:=b;
end;
for i:=1 to n do
begin
write(x[i],' ');
if i mod 2 = 0 then s:=s+x[i];
end;
writeln;
writeln('s = ',s);
end.
Пример:
<span>n = 6
Исходный массив:
x[1]=12
x[2]=54
x[3]=71
x[4]=30
x[5]=47
x[6]=29
29 47 30 71 54 12
s = 130</span>